The legendary Jordan 5 signifies a pivotal moment in athletic design. Initially released in 1990, it showcased a distinctive aesthetic that strayed from earlier models. Notable features like the bright 3M panelling , the see-through rubber sole , and the more info easily recognizable "shark fins" on the lateral portion of the shoe’s design cemented its place as an pioneering masterpiece. Beyond its visual appeal, the Jordan 5 furthermore utilized new materials that aided to its functionality and reliable legacy.

This Air 5: Story and Journey of an Classic
The distinctive Jordan 5, debuted in 1990, soon became an style phenomenon. Drawing inspiration on aviation design concepts and Michael’s love for vintage P-51 Mustang fighter jet, this featured innovative appearance features, like the signature reflective laces and its shark bottom. Over time, multiple versions have, such as the original "Black Metallic" to numerous recent partnerships, cementing its reputation as the timeless basketball shoe and the true representation of footwear fashion.
